Their support page says you can pay via Paypal also: https://runbox.com/price-plans/payment-methods/

Quote:
Runbox currently accepts Visa, MasterCard and American Express cards via our payments partner Stripe.

Pre-paid cards from the issuers above may also be accepted for payment. However, some providers of pre-paid cards do have restrictions that might affect whether our payment processor (Stripe) is able to process your particular card.

If your card is declined by your bank, you should contact them and ask them to allow the payment. If after contacting your bank you continue to have any problems using your card, you can often use your card to pay using PayPal, even without an account with them.

Note that we don’t support automatic renewals via PayPal.

Anothr Runbox Question

When i send an email my full name is sent in front of the outgoing email address. Back in the good ol days there was a link to eliminate my name and let just the outgoing email go
Any one know if Runbox still gives option to remove senders name from the out going email

Yes, in the NEW interface, I think you go under Settings > Account > Identities and you should be able to change it. HOWEVER, I recently had some minor weird issue with it, and I chalked that up to it being a beta. Just test things out to make sure it's working the way you want it to.

So you can switch back to the OLD interface too and go to Preferences, and then you can select the folder (Inbox, for example), and adjust your name.

Still, I'd suggest testing it there too, once you tweak your settings, since if you switch back and forth between v6 and v7 like I do, I had a minor little issue with identities and folder preferences at some point, and I had to tweak again.
